I have not given up anything because of the cost. I have given up things because of the health factor. I am buying more generic brands. Oh, I am also making a spreadsheet of what things cost at the two big grocery stores here, Walmart & Target...I was a tad surprised. A gallon of skim milk at one of the grocery stores was $3.06 and a gallon of skim milk at Walmart was $3.67. If I didn't pay attention and start the spreadsheet, I would have thought that Walmart was cheaper. Both were generic brands, so I am not comparing Kemps to a generic brand etc.
